Alan Daniel Maman, professionally known as the Alchemist, is an American hip hop producer and DJ. He began his music career in 1991 in the hip hop duo the Whooliganz under the moniker Mudfoot, along with now-actor Scott Caan. He has produced music since the 1990s.

Russian Roulette is the third solo studio album by American hip hop producer and recording artist The Alchemist. It was released on July 17, 2012, through Decon. Produced entirely by the Alchemist, it features guest appearances from Action Bronson, AG Da Coroner, Big Twins, Boldy James, Chuuwee, Danny Brown, Durag Dynasty, Evidence, Fashawn, Guilty Simpson, MidaZ, Meyhem Lauren, Mr. Muthafuckin' eXquire, Roc Marciano, Schoolboy Q and Willie the Kid.

(M.1.C.S.) My 1st Chemistry Set is the debut studio album by Detroit rapper Boldy James and producer The Alchemist, released on October 15, 2013 through Decon. It was preceded by Boldy James' EP, Grand Quarters (2013). M.1.C.S. was entirely produced by The Alchemist and features guest appearances from Action Bronson, Domo Genesis, Earl Sweatshirt, Freeway, King Chip and Vince Staples among others. On September 12, 2013, the lead single from the album, "Moochie," was leaked onto the Internet. The following single, "Reform School," was leaked on October 7, 2013. M.1.C.S. was generally well received by music critics. Complex named it amongst the best albums of October 2013.

Alvin Lamar Worthy, known professionally as Westside Gunn, is an American rapper. He is a co-founder of independent hip-hop label Griselda Records. He is the paternal half-brother of rapper Conway the Machine and cousin of rapper Benny the Butcher, both of whom he frequently collaborates with. Westside Gunn has released five studio albums in addition to an extensive catalog of mixtapes. Gunn was affiliated with Shady Records from 2017 to 2020, but has since returned to independent status.

Supreme Blientele is the second studio album by American rapper Westside Gunn from Buffalo, New York. It was released on June 22, 2018 through Griselda Records with distribution by Empire Distribution. Its titles allude to Ghostface Killah's album Supreme Clientele and the Canadian professional wrestler Chris Benoit. Production was handled by Daringer, The Alchemist, Pete Rock, Harry Fraud, Sadhugold, Roc Marciano, Statik Selektah, 9th Wonder and Nephew Hesh. The album includes guest appearances from Anderson .Paak, Benny the Butcher, Bro AA Rashid, Busta Rhymes, Conway the Machine, Crimeapple, Elzhi, Keisha Plum, Jadakiss and Roc Marciano.

Jeremie Damon Pennick, known professionally as Benny the Butcher, or simply Benny, is an American rapper and songwriter. He came to prominence in 2018 following the release of his debut album, Tana Talk 3. Along with his cousins and fellow rappers Westside Gunn and Conway The Machine, with which he forms the collective Griselda, he is known for his '90s inspired rap songs and is often credited with leading a revival of the so called 'grimy' and 'gritty' hip hop music, influenced by mafioso and drug dealing themes.

Griselda Records is an American independent hip hop record label based in Buffalo, New York. It was founded by rapper Westside Gunn, his brother Conway the Machine, and Mach-Hommy in 2012. In addition to the founding members, Benny the Butcher and in-house producer Daringer make up the flagship artists of the Griselda Records roster.

Pray for Paris is the third studio album by American rapper Westside Gunn. It was released on April 17, 2020 through Griselda Records with distribution by Empire Distribution. The album was produced by Daringer, Beat Butcha, the Alchemist, DJ Muggs, and DJ Premier. It features guest appearances from Benny the Butcher, Conway the Machine, Joey Badass, Tyler, the Creator, Boldy James, Freddie Gibbs, Roc Marciano, Wale, Joyce Wrice, Billie Essco, Keisha Plum, and Cartier Williams. The album debuted at number 67 on the Billboard 200.

Tana Talk 3 is the debut studio album by American rapper Benny the Butcher. It was released on November 23, 2018 through Griselda Records and Black Soprano Family. The album is exclusively produced by The Alchemist and Daringer. It features guest appearances by labelmates Conway the Machine and Westside Gunn and other appearances by Keisha Plum, Meyhem Lauren, Melanie Rutherford and Royce da 5'9".

Tana Talk 4 is the third studio album by American rapper Benny the Butcher. It was released on March 11, 2022, through Griselda Records and Black Soprano Family and distributed by Empire Distribution. It is the fourth installment in his Tana Talk series, following up the 2018 album Tana Talk 3. The album was produced by The Alchemist, Daringer and Beat Butcha. It features guest appearances by labelmates Conway the Machine and Westside Gunn and other appearances by J. Cole, Diddy, Stove God Cooks, Boldy James, and 38 Spesh.
